   Protein powder 


Protein powder is probably the single most popular workout supplement. This is because when you want to build muscle through strength training your body requires more protein for a muscle repair and growth after a workout. While this doesn't mean you have to use protein powders to reach your recommended daily protein intake, consuming enough protein every day can be tricky.

Especially when you don't have time to prepare high protein meals all the time, a good protein powder can really make your life easier. That is why most athletes and bodybuilders use protein powders in addition to a balanced diet. You probably already know this and might just be asking yourself which protein powder is best.

From whey to casein to vegan, there are a lot of options to choose from and within the fitness and bodybuilding community there is alw always a lot of discussion about which is best. But as I explain here, it most likely won't matter all that much which kind of protein you buy as long as you take it regularly. So just go with the one you like best (unless it's soy or beef protein).
